Why This Role Matters

As Principal Product Security Consultant, you will play a pivotal role in shaping how security is embedded into Hansen's software ecosystem. This is not a compliance‑only role; it is about modern, scalable, developer‑aligned product security.

You Will

  • Define and mature Hansen's enterprise Product Security and Application Security program.
  • Enable engineering teams to deliver faster, safer software through pragmatic tooling, guidance, and automation.
  • Act as a hands‑on technical authority and trusted advisor, influencing how security is designed into products from day one.
  • Champion the use of AI and automation in the SDLC, improving signal quality, reducing friction, and driving meaningful security outcomes.

Your impact will be visible across global product teams, influencing everything from threat modelling and tooling adoption to developer enablement and vulnerability transparency.

What You’ll Do

  • Lead Product & Application Security Uplift: Design, evolve, and execute an enterprise‑wide Product Security and AppSec program aligned to business priorities.
  • Embed Security into the SDLC: Provide hands‑on guidance to engineering teams on secure design, development, and delivery practices.
  • Own AppSec Tooling & Platforms: Operate, improve, and optimise security tooling (SAST, DAST, SCA, IaC, container scanning), reducing noise while increasing adoption and impact.
  • Enable Teams, Not Block Them: Evangelise secure development practices through enablement, documentation, and a thriving Security Champions program.
  • Threat Model What Matters: Establish and operationalise threat modelling practices across products, coaching teams to think adversarially and proactively.
  • Bring AI into AppSec: Champion and integrate AI capabilities within the SDLC and security platforms to enhance detection, prioritisation, and insight.
  • Measure & Communicate Risk: Build meaningful reporting that provides leadership with a clear, enterprise‑wide view of product security posture and vulnerability risk.

What You Bring

  • Proven experience leading or building a Product Security program in a complex software environment.
  • Strong background in software engineering or DevOps, or equivalent demonstrable technical expertise.
  • Deep knowledge of application security tooling, platforms, and CI/CD integrations.
  • Experience configuring policies, tests, and guardrails within modern delivery pipelines.
  • Ability to influence, coach, and partner with engineers and product leaders.
  • Confidence operating as a senior approval and advisory layer for higher‑risk application architectures.
  • A pragmatic mindset - focused on outcomes, not theory.

Nice to Have

  • Familiarity with security frameworks and their practical application in AppSec.
  • Experience with threat modelling methodologies (and training others to use them).
  • Awareness of regulatory and privacy requirements (e.g. GDPR).
  • Relevant security certifications (e.g. CSSLP, GIAC, AWS/Azure Security, OSCP, CEH).
